Ecosystem of the Digital Shekel
The proposed ecosystem surrounding the digital shekel, developed by the Bank of Israel, envisions a comprehensive framework involving multiple stakeholders, each playing a distinct and vital role. Central to this ecosystem is the Bank of Israel, which serves as the issuer and overseer of the digital currency. This institution is tasked with ensuring the stability, security, and regulatory compliance of the digital shekel, while also fostering public trust in its use.
Financial institutions, including banks and payment service providers, are pivotal players in the digital shekel ecosystem. They will facilitate the issuance, transfer, and conversion of the digital currency into traditional fiat money, thus ensuring seamless integration into the existing financial systems. Their role extends further to creating interfaces that allow consumers and merchants to engage with the digital shekel efficiently. Additionally, these institutions may offer ancillary services, such as financial education regarding the usage and benefits of digital currencies.
Merchants also have a significant stake in the ecosystem as they will need to adapt their payment systems to accommodate this new form of currency. The digital shekel presents potential benefits for merchants, such as reduced transaction costs, faster payment processing, and decreased reliance on physical cash. However, challenges may arise, including the necessity for technological upgrades and consumer adaptation to digital payment modalities.
Lastly, consumers are critical to the digital shekel's success. They will be responsible for adopting the digital currency for daily transactions, and their acceptance hinges on the perceived benefits such as convenience, security, and enhanced privacy. While the digital shekel promises a more efficient transactional experience, there are also concerns regarding security, privacy, and the potential for overreliance on digital systems. Understanding the interactions among these stakeholders will be fundamental in assessing the overall impact of the digital shekel on the Israeli economy.
Technical framework of the Digital Shekel
The technical framework of the digital shekel is a cornerstone of its proposed design, emphasizing the necessity for robust functionality, security, and user privacy. At the core of this digital currency lies distributed ledger technology (DLT), which is renowned for its ability to facilitate secure, transparent transactions. The adaptation of DLT for the digital shekel promises to deliver scalability and high transaction speeds that traditional payment systems often struggle to achieve.
Utilizing blockchain technology, the digital shekel aims to record all transactions in an immutable ledger, ensuring that once data is verified, it cannot be altered without consensus from the network participants. This feature is pivotal for preventing fraud and maintaining trust within the digital currency ecosystem. Moreover, the scalability of the blockchain solution allows the Bank of Israel to accommodate a growing number of users and transaction volume without compromising performance. The design envisions thousands of transactions per second, enabling the digital shekel to rival existing payment systems.
Interoperability is another critical aspect of the technical design. The digital shekel intends to be compatible with existing payment infrastructures, simplifying integration for users and merchants alike. This consideration is vital for ensuring that the digital shekel can coexist with other currencies, both digital and fiat. By providing a seamless transition for both consumers and businesses, the digital shekel not only stands to enhance user experience but also promotes widespread adoption.
Furthermore, user privacy and data protection remain paramount in the digital shekel's design. Robust encryption methods and privacy-preserving features will be layered into its framework to safeguard personal information while still allowing for regulatory compliance. This balance between financial privacy and transparency is crucial for fostering public trust and ensuring the successful implementation of the digital shekel.
Regulatory considerations for implementation
The introduction of the digital shekel by the Bank of Israel necessitates a comprehensive regulatory framework that addresses multiple facets of its operation within the existing financial landscape. As a central bank digital currency (CBDC), the digital shekel must comply with prevailing financial regulations that govern monetary transactions, ensuring that it operates within a legally sanctioned structure that enhances systemic stability.
One crucial aspect of this regulatory framework is adherence to anti-money laundering (AML) measures. The digital shekel must integrate rigorous AML protocols to prevent illicit activities such as money laundering and terrorist financing. This involves establishing robust identity verification processes, maintaining transaction records, and implementing monitoring systems to detect suspicious activities. These measures will help ensure that the digital shekel retains the integrity of currency transactions and maintains public confidence in its usage.
Additionally, consumer protection laws must be embedded in the operational guidelines governing the digital shekel. This involves establishing clear mechanisms for dispute resolution, safeguarding user data, and ensuring the transparency of transactions. Effective communication regarding the rights of consumers, including the ability to report fraud or unauthorized use, is critical to fostering public trust in this new digital currency.
Furthermore, the Bank of Israel is mindful of the potential risks associated with the adoption of the digital shekel, particularly concerning cybersecurity threats and market volatility. To address these concerns, the regulatory framework will incorporate measures to bolster cybersecurity defenses, ensuring that the infrastructure supporting the digital shekel is resilient against breaches. This includes regular assessments and updates to security protocols as well as collaboration with cybersecurity experts to stay ahead of evolving threats.
Ultimately, the establishment of a robust legal framework is essential for the successful implementation of the digital shekel, ensuring it serves as a secure, efficient, and trusted medium of exchange in Israel's economy.
